officerscrub reacted to GravelRoadCop in Check out ELS for V!Yes. ELS has it's own integrated Traffic Control System. The sirens will move cars directly ahead of you forward when the right conditions are met. Some driver will react differently to your siren tones, and air-horn intensity, so make sure you use all four available siren tone options. ELS will take control of the cars directly in front of you (with range of about 40m forward). This is very useful at intersections when all the lanes are taken up.
Rest assured, ELS will have LAPD spec headlight flashers, hide-a-way system pattern and light bar patterns. Your LAPD models will go nicely with ELS :)
